A case of successful conservative therapy of patient with severe heart failure caused by ischemic heart disease: case report
The development of heart failure in any patient causes a lot of concerns in view of the deterioration of quality of life of the latter. A clinical case of a patient with severe heart failure with a low left ventricular ejection fraction is described. The uniqueness of the demonstrated case consisted...
